Wide and Padded Shoulder Straps

One of the most important features of a health-friendly shoulder bag is a wide, padded strap. Wider straps distribute weight across a larger surface area, reducing pressure on the shoulder. Padding adds an extra layer of comfort and helps prevent the strap from digging into the skin during extended use.

Lightweight Construction

The bag itself should be lightweight before any items are placed inside. Heavy materials add unnecessary weight and increase the burden on your body. Lightweight fabrics and soft yet durable materials make carrying daily essentials more comfortable.

Adjustable Strap Length

An adjustable strap allows users to customize the fit according to their height and body type. Proper strap adjustment helps position the bag correctly against the body, improving balance and reducing strain on the shoulders and back.

Multiple Compartments for Better Organization

A well-organized shoulder bag helps distribute weight more evenly. Multiple compartments prevent items from gathering in one area, reducing imbalance and making it easier to access belongings without unnecessary movement.

Appropriate Size and Capacity

A health-friendly shoulder bag should match your daily needs. An oversized bag may encourage carrying unnecessary items, increasing overall weight. Choosing a size that comfortably holds essentials helps maintain a manageable load.

Durable and Supportive Structure

A sturdy bag maintains its shape and provides better support for the items inside. Reinforced stitching, quality materials, and a balanced design contribute to greater comfort and long-term durability.
